Introduction to Google Ads

Google Ads is a powerful online advertising platform that allows businesses to reach potential customers through Google’s search engine and display network. With the Pay-Per-Click (PPC) model, advertisers only pay when someone clicks on their ad, helping to optimize costs and improve audience targeting. 1. Use the Ad Preview & Diagnosis Tool

Google provides the Ad Preview and Diagnosis Tool, which allows you to check your ads without affecting actual impressions. This tool helps you:

  • See how your ad appears on Google Search.
  • Diagnose errors and determine why your ad is not displaying.

2. Check Ad Status in Your Google Ads Account

Log into your Google Ads account and review the status of your campaigns, ad groups, and keywords in the dashboard:

  • If there are warning icons (🔴/🟡), read the accompanying message to identify the issue.
  • Common issues include budget depletion, invalid keywords, or policy violations.

3. Factors That Affect Ad Visibility

  • Limited budget: Ads may stop showing if the daily budget is exhausted.
  • Low keyword quality score: A low Quality Score can reduce ad ranking.
  • Google policy violations: Ads may be disapproved if they violate content or setup policies.

1. Insufficient Budget or Account Balance

🔹 Cause:

  • Your daily budget or account balance has run out, causing ads to stop running.

✅ Solution:

  • Check your account balance and ensure there is enough budget to keep ads running.
  • Increase your budget if necessary to maintain consistent ad visibility.

2. Ads Disabled by Google

🔹 Cause:

  • Your ad content violates Google’s policies, such as misleading information, prohibited products, or inappropriate keywords.

✅ Solution:

  • Review and edit your ad content to comply with Google’s guidelines.
  • Resubmit the ad for approval.

3. Incorrect Campaign Configuration

🔹 Cause:

  • Incorrect targeting (wrong location, device, or audience settings).
  • Low bid amounts causing ads to be outcompeted.

✅ Solution:

  • Review and optimize your campaign settings.
  • Use the Ad Preview & Diagnosis Tool to detect errors.

4. High Competition in Your Industry

🔹 Cause:

  • Competitors may have higher bids or better Quality Scores.

✅ Solution:

  • Optimize your Quality Score to reduce costs.
  • Use long-tail keywords with lower competition.

5. Ads Pending Approval

🔹 Cause:

  • New or edited ads require Google’s approval before they can be displayed.

✅ Solution:

  • Wait for the approval process (usually a few hours to a day).
  • Ensure your ad follows policies for faster approval.

6. Slow Landing Page Speed

🔹 Cause:

  • Google ranks ads lower if the landing page loads slowly, reducing visibility.

✅ Solution:

  • Use Google PageSpeed Insights to check and optimize your landing page.
  • Improve loading speed by optimizing images, code, and hosting.

1. How Google Ads Works

Google Ads operates on an ad auction system, where:

  • Advertisers select keywords relevant to their product/service.
  • Google runs an auction whenever a user searches for that keyword.
  • The ad ranking is based on bid amount (CPC) and Quality Score.
  • Ads can appear on Google Search or the Google Display Network (GDN).

2. How to Optimize Your Google Ads Campaign

Step 1: Optimize Keywords

  • Use Google Keyword Planner to select effective keywords.
  • Add negative keywords to avoid unwanted clicks.

Step 2: Write Engaging Ads

  • Include main keywords in the headline.
  • Write a clear and concise description highlighting product benefits.

Step 3: Improve Quality Score

  • Create optimized landing pages that match ad content.
  • Increase Click-Through Rate (CTR) by using ad extensions.

Step 4: Monitor & Adjust

  • Use Google Ads Reports to track performance and optimize campaigns.
  • Conduct A/B testing to determine the best-performing ads.
